Circum-areolar mastectomy with immediate reconstruction (CAMIR)

Summary
This study presents a new surgical technique for nipple-sparing mastectomy reconstruction using a latissimus dorsi myocutaneous flap and tissue expander, achieving excellent cosmetic outcomes with no local cancer recurrence. The method offers a safe and aesthetically pleasing option for breast cancer patients.
Area of Science:
- Surgical Oncology
- Plastic and Reconstructive Surgery
- Breast Cancer Treatment
Background:
- Nipple involvement in breast cancer necessitates mastectomy, often leading to aesthetic concerns.
- Traditional mastectomy techniques can result in significant cosmetic defects.
- Immediate reconstruction aims to improve patient outcomes and satisfaction.
Purpose of the Study:
- To evaluate an oncologically safe and aesthetically acceptable technique for mastectomy.
- To assess the efficacy of using a latissimus dorsi myocutaneous flap and tissue expander for immediate breast reconstruction.
- To address neoplastic involvement of the nipple with a focus on cosmetic results.
Main Methods:
- A cohort of 14 patients (mean age 40) underwent circum-areolar mastectomy with immediate reconstruction.
- The latissimus dorsi myocutaneous flap and tissue expander were utilized for reconstruction.
- Cosmetic outcomes were objectively assessed by an independent observer reviewing pre- and post-operative photographs.
Main Results:
- No local recurrences were observed during a mean follow-up of 11.4 months.
- Two deaths occurred: one due to pulmonary embolism and one from distant metastatic disease.
- The cosmetic assessment yielded a high score of 47 out of 56 (84%).
Conclusions:
- Mastectomy with immediate reconstruction is a viable option for patients with nipple-involved tumors.
- This technique can achieve favorable cosmetic results.
- The reconstructed nipple is created from the skin attached to the latissimus dorsi flap.
